Understanding the Recuperation Timeline
When you have actually undertaken cataract surgical procedure, it's important for you to recognize the timeline of your recovery. The first couple of days after the surgical treatment are critical for your recovery process. You might experience light discomfort and fuzzy vision throughout this moment, but it needs to gradually boost.
Within a week, most individuals observe a considerable renovation in their vision. However, it's important to bear in mind that everyone's recuperation timeline might vary. It usually takes about a month for your eyes to totally heal and for your vision to stabilize.

Tips for a Smooth and Successful Recovery
As you advance your journey towards a smooth and successful recuperation after cataract surgical procedure, it is necessary to prioritize remainder and follow your medical professional's instructions very closely. Resting enables your eyes to heal effectively and avoids any stress or issues.
Prevent any type of laborious activities, particularly those that require bending, lifting, or straining, as they can tax your eyes and postpone the recovery procedure.
Additionally, make certain to take any type of recommended medications as routed by your medical professional. These drugs help in reducing swelling and stop infection.
Maintain your eyes safeguarded by putting on sunglasses when outdoors and preventing dusty or great smoky atmospheres.
Lastly, go to all follow-up visits with your medical professional to make sure that your recovery is proceeding efficiently and any potential issues are dealt with quickly.
